To install and operate the oventrop Aktor M 2P, please follow the instructions below:
1. Installation:
- Ensure that the power supply is disconnected before starting the installation process.
- Mount the Aktor M 2P onto the valve using the provided screws.
- Connect the three-prong cable to the Aktor M 2P and secure it properly.
- Make sure the cable is routed safely to avoid any damage.
- Ensure that the Aktor M 2P is properly sealed to maintain its IP54 ingress protection rating.
2. Operating Voltage:
- The Aktor M 2P operates with an operating voltage of 100-230 V AC +10% 50/60 Hz.
- Ensure that the power supply matches the specified voltage range.
3. Power Consumption:
- The Aktor M 2P consumes 8.5 W during operation and 0.5 W at the ends of the stroke.
- This information is important for power supply planning and energy efficiency considerations.
4. Control:
- The Aktor M 2P operates in a 2-position control mode with a normally open contact.
- This means that it can switch between two states, either fully open or fully closed.
5. Max. Stroke and Actuating Force:
- The Aktor M 2P has a maximum stroke of 6.5 mm.
- It exerts an actuating force of more than 90 N to ensure proper valve operation.
6. Ingress Protection and Temperature:
- The Aktor M 2P has an ingress protection rating of IP54, providing protection against dust and water splashes.
- It is suitable for use with a medium temperature of up to +95 °C (130 °C for less than 10 minutes).
- Ensure that the temperature limits are not exceeded to prevent damage to the device.
7. Ambient Temperature:
- The Aktor M 2P can operate within an ambient temperature range of 0 to +60 °C.
- Avoid exposing the device to extreme temperatures outside this range.
8. Connection Cable:
- The Aktor M 2P comes with a 1.5-meter long three-prong cable.
- Ensure that the cable is properly connected and secured.
9. Input Current:
- The Aktor M 2P has an input current of 1 mA.
- This information is relevant for electrical safety considerations.
